Abstract:
This paper presents another view for image compression. The image is represented
as a 3-D graph or surface, where the third dimension corresponds to color z'-ffx.yj.
The idea is to find the equation of an implicit surface that realizes z. The
results produce comparative quality to the current techniques. However, a great
advantage will be gained, that is the fast decoding process. It will be simply
achieved by just a matrix multiplication of spatial information by the
coefficients of the basis functions.
